package datapol

import (
	"fmt"
	"net/http"
	"strings"
	"testing"

	"github.com/stretchr/testify/assert"
)

const (
	marker = "hunter2"
)

type withDatapolTag struct {
	Key string `json:"key" datapolicy:"password"`
}

type withExternalType struct {
	Header http.Header `json:"header"`
}

type noDatapol struct {
	Key string `json:"key"`
}

type datapolInMember struct {
	secrets withDatapolTag
}

type datapolInSlice struct {
	secrets []withDatapolTag
}

type datapolInMap struct {
	secrets map[string]withDatapolTag
}

type datapolBehindPointer struct {
	secrets *withDatapolTag
}

func TestValidate(t *testing.T) {
	testcases := []struct {
		name      string
		value     interface{}
		expect    []string
		badFilter bool
	}{{
		name:   "Empty password",
		value:  withDatapolTag{},
		expect: []string{},
	}, {
		name: "Non-empty password",
		value: withDatapolTag{
			Key: marker,
		},
		expect: []string{"password"},
	}, {
		name:   "empty external type",
		value:  withExternalType{Header: http.Header{}},
		expect: []string{},
	}, {
		name: "external type",
		value: withExternalType{Header: http.Header{
			"Authorization": []string{"Bearer hunter2"},
		}},
		expect: []string{"password", "token"},
	}, {
		name:      "no datapol tag",
		value:     noDatapol{Key: marker},
		expect:    []string{},
		badFilter: true,
	}, {
		name: "nested",
		value: datapolInMember{
			secrets: withDatapolTag{
				Key: marker,
			},
		},
		expect: []string{"password"},
	}, {
		name: "nested in pointer",
		value: datapolBehindPointer{
			secrets: &withDatapolTag{Key: marker},
		},
		expect: []string{},
	}, {
		name: "nested in slice",
		value: datapolInSlice{
			secrets: []withDatapolTag{{Key: marker}},
		},
		expect: []string{"password"},
	}, {
		name: "nested in map",
		value: datapolInMap{
			secrets: map[string]withDatapolTag{
				"key": {Key: marker},
			},
		},
		expect: []string{"password"},
	}, {
		name: "nested in map but empty",
		value: datapolInMap{
			secrets: map[string]withDatapolTag{
				"key": {},
			},
		},
		expect: []string{},
	}, {
		name: "struct in interface",
		value: struct{ v interface{} }{v: withDatapolTag{
			Key: marker,
		}},
		expect: []string{"password"},
	}, {
		name: "structptr in interface",
		value: struct{ v interface{} }{v: &withDatapolTag{
			Key: marker,
		}},
		expect: []string{},
	}}
	for _, tc := range testcases {
		res := Verify(tc.value)
		if !assert.ElementsMatch(t, tc.expect, res) {
			t.Errorf("Wrong set of tags for %q. expect %v, got %v", tc.name, tc.expect, res)
		}
		if !tc.badFilter {
			formatted := fmt.Sprintf("%v", tc.value)
			if strings.Contains(formatted, marker) != (len(tc.expect) > 0) {
				t.Errorf("Filter decision doesn't match formatted value for %q: tags: %v, format: %s", tc.name, tc.expect, formatted)
			}
		}
	}
}
